G513 RGX is a 1990 Talbot Express 1300 P in White with a 1,971c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 26 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.5%.
Across all 1990 Talbot Express 1300 P models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.1% with a typical mileage of 63,974 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Talbot Express 1300 P f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 552 recorded failures. If you're considering buying G513 RGX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Talbot Express 1300 P typ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 36 years old, this Talbot Express 1300 P is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
